When The Student Is Ready The Teacher Appears - I

There's An Old Saying, When The Student Is Ready The Teacher Appears.

Looking back in 2002: I had a little windfall from a project I worked hard at and with that win, I bought myself a brand new SUV - bright yellow it was - absolutely outstanding! I only had a moment of happiness then back to a void within me that was all too familiar. That was when I started my journey of active search.

I must have searched on and off for close to three years and in Oct 2005, in a mountain - Mt. Abu - in Northern State of Rajasthan, I finally found what I seek only to realise now that this is the begining of true living...and true being. It was very much an Ah-Ha! for me. The love I felt at the gathering - little that I knew back then that it was a spiritual gathering. Little that I realise that I was fortunate to be amongst a group of very stable-minded yogi. That was also a period of my life when I was near burnt-out. I remembered I was invited to Peace of Mind Retreat organised by the Brahma Kumaris World Spiritual University. I did not had much time in my preparation as I just decided to accept the invitation and decided to just go with the flow of things.

Hours before I took off my journey from Kuching, I picked up the Celestine Prophecy as it was I thought at that time a book most apt for a journey to Mt Abu. Yes, that was the begining of a series of amazing happening in my life that I can only reason it as it has got to do with a Greater Force. I simply got so spell-bound with the Celestine Prophecy that I began to live the book in my journey to Mt Abu and my stay there. The essence of it was whoever you meet - there's a reason to it. I simply live the moment and let the moment come to me and go with the flow. It was magical! They often says it's magical Mt Abu. Yes it is. Years of yoga by yogi who practice purity simply purifies the atmosphere there.

This was the begining of my journey from a yuppie to a yogi.
